site stats

Hashing buckets

WebIf your computer's word size is four bytes, then you will be hashing keys that are multiples of 4. Needless to say that choosing m to be a multiple of 4 would be a terrible choice: you would have 3 m / 4 buckets completely empty, and all of your keys colliding in the remaining m / 4 buckets. In general: WebClosed Hashing, Using Buckets. Hash Integer: Hash Strings: Animation Speed

Locality-sensitive hashing - Wikipedia

WebFeb 4, 2024 · 5. Watch this Example as YouTube Video. 1. HashSet Buckets Overview. In the past Java HashSet example, we learnt about the Java HashSet and its Set implementation and how it keeps the uniqueness. Now, in this example, we will learn about the Buckets and how it aids quicker retrieval and search. These buckets improve the … WebFeb 4, 2024 · Universal hashing: a simple and effective means for generating hashes is as follows: generate two random numbers a and b in the interval [0, D), and return the value of hash (x) = (a*x+b) mod D, … horseflex glucosamine msm https://prosper-local.com

15. 5. Bucket Hashing - Virginia Tech

Web15. 5.1. Bucket Hashing ¶. Closed hashing stores all records directly in the hash table. Each record R with key value k R has a home position that is h ( k R), the slot computed … WebModular hashing. With modular hashing, the hash function is simply h(k) = k mod m for some m (usually, the number of buckets). The value k is an integer hash code generated from the key. If m is a power of two (i.e., m=2p ), then h(k) is just the p lowest-order bits of k. WebTL;DR. The Policy Hash Table has 3-6x faster insertion/deletion and 4-10x increase for writes/reads. As far as I can tell, there are no downsides. The policy hash table (specifically the open-addressing version), beats out unordered_map in all my benchmarks. PS: Make sure you read the section a better hash function and use it — I'd recommend ... psi to m of water

Closed Hashing (Buckets) Visualization - University of San …

Category:Hash Table Explained: What it Is and How to Implement It …

Tags:Hashing buckets

Hashing buckets

Introduction to Hashing – Data Structure and Algorithm …

WebApr 8, 2024 · The initial capacity sets the number of buckets when the internal hashtable is created. The number of buckets will be automatically increased if the current size gets full. The load factor specifies the HashSet’s fullness threshold at which its capacity is automatically increased. Once the number of entries in the hash table exceeds the ... WebLocality Sensitive Hashing (LSH) is one of the most popular approximate nearest neighbors search (ANNS) methods. At its core, it is a hashing function that allows us to group similar items into the same hash buckets. So, given an impossibly huge dataset — we run all of our items through the hashing function, sorting items into buckets.

Hashing buckets

Did you know?

WebJun 1, 2024 · How to hash to a fixed number of buckets A good method for mapping to a fixed number of locations is to use the modulus operator: h (hashCode) = hashCode mod N Where N is the length of the array we … WebJan 25, 2024 · A hash table, also known as a hash map, is a data structure that maps keys to values. It is one part of a technique called hashing, the other of which is a hash function. A hash function is an algorithm that …

WebNov 7, 2024 · A good implementation will use a hash function that distributes the records evenly among the buckets so that as few records as possible go into the overflow … WebA hash table contains several slots or buckets to hold key value pairs. It requires a hashing function to determine the correct bucket to place the data into. A hashing function is any algorithm, or formula, that is applied to a key to generate a unique number. Each data item to be stored must have a key and a value.

WebIn computer science, locality-sensitive hashing ( LSH) is an algorithmic technique that hashes similar input items into the same "buckets" with high probability. [1] ( The number of buckets is much smaller than the … WebI'm looking for an implementation of Cuckoo Hashing that allows to specify the number of hash functions (x) and the number of buckets per cell (y).. My goal is to experiment the load factor for each variation of (x, y) and put in a table to convey the finding. The load factor here is how much space is utilized before fail to insert after having reached z number of …

WebIn computer science, locality-sensitive hashing ( LSH) is an algorithmic technique that hashes similar input items into the same "buckets" with high probability. [1] (. The …

WebAug 24, 2011 · The M slots of the hash table are divided into B buckets, with each bucket consisting of M/B slots. The hash function assigns each record to the first slot within one … psi to miles per hourWebThe 16 hash buckets are set up depending on the type of load balancing and the number of active paths. The simple case is for an even number of paths. The 16 buckets are evenly filled with the active paths. If 16 isn't divisible by the number of active paths, the last few buckets that represent the remainder are disabled. The following table ... horseflies imagesWebJan 27, 2024 · Static hashing . In static hashing, a search key value is provided by the designed Hash Function always computes the same address For example, if mod (4) hash function is used, then it shall generate only 5 values.; The number of buckets provided remains unchanged at all times; Bucket address = h (K): the address of the desired data … horsefly air conditionerWeb1 hour ago · Retailing for £14.90, a banana shaped bag dubbed “ the round mini ” has become Uniqlo’s bestselling bag of all time, selling out seven times in the last 18 months according to the company ... horsefly aiWebApr 5, 2024 · For JsonHash we use 64 buckets. The bucket is calculated from the lower order bits of the hash. For example, the one-byte Pearson Hash of “cs-uri-stem:api” is … horsefly and honeybeeWebDec 14, 2015 · Here is how you create a minimal perfect hash table: Hash the items into buckets – there will be collisions at this point. Sort the buckets from most items to fewest items. Find a salt value for each bucket such that when all items in that bucket are hashed, they claim only unclaimed slots. Store this array of salt values for later. horsefly alternative nameWebSep 16, 2015 · The number of buckets needs to be smaller and the hash codes need to be modulo-ed to the number of buckets. If the number of buckets is a power of 2, you can use a mask of the lowest bits. psi to mph chart